From T. H. Farrer 5 June 1870
3, Gloucester Terrace, | Regent’s Park.
5 June/70
My dear Mr Darwin
I could not find any thing to send to F. Müller so I wrote him a long screed of a letter, giving the gist of my notions about the corona &c of Passiflora. I hope he wont be bored.1
Sincerely yours | T H Farrer
